Matthew J. Peluso, DDS '93 is the owner of Peluso Orthodontics, with locations in both Cedar Grove and Wayne, NJ.
Dr. Matthew J. Peluso grew up in Sheepshead Bay, Brooklyn, and attended St. Edmunds Elementary School. He attended Xaverian and graduated in 1993. At Xaverian, Dr. Peluso was involved in many extracurricular activities, including the SCC, the Wrestling team, and the Lacrosse Team. After graduating from Xaverian, Dr. Peluso attended Rutgers University in New Brunswick, NJ where he received a B.A. degree. Upon graduating from Rutgers University, Dr. Peluso attended dental school at UMDNJ which is now Rutgers Dental School in Newark, NJ, and was elected into the Omicron Kappa Upsilon National Honor Society. Upon graduation from dental school, Dr. Peluso was awarded the prestigious Stanley S. Bergen, Jr. Medal of Excellence. Dr. Peluso then completed an orthodontic residency program at the University of Maryland, earning both a specialty certificate in orthodontics, as well as a Master of Science degree. He is a published researcher, a Diplomate of the American Board of Orthodontics, and an esteemed member of numerous professional dental organizations. Dr. Peluso is the owner of Peluso Orthodontics, with locations in both Cedar Grove and Wayne, NJ.
